NOTE:
Many believe that these signs are yet to come; however, the first
signs in the sky occurred at the end of persecution and just prior to
the close of tribulation in 1798. On
May 19, 1780, the sun was darkened and that same night the moon
appeared as blood. (Actually
notes from that day). Then on
November 13, 1833, the heavens seemed ablaze as the greatest
meteoric shower ever to be recorded was observed over North America.
Meteors were falling at a rate of 60,000 per hour.

NOTE:
On November 1, 1755,
The
Great Lisbon earthquake affected almost all of Europe. Tens of
thousands lost their lives on land, while many drowned because of a
tsunami that followed. The day ended with a massive fire that burnt yet
another 10,000 plus to death. (See
